A growing shortage of Liquefied Petroleum Gas (LPG) could disrupt mobile and internet connectivity as telecom tower manufacturers face supply constraints. LPG plays a key role in the zinc-coating process that protects towers from corrosion during production. With gas supplies tightening, several companies are also considering halting operations.

The Indian government has relaxed foreign direct investment (FDI) rules for countries sharing land borders with India, including China, Bangladesh, Pakistan, Nepal, Bhutan, Myanmar and Afghanistan. Under amendments to Press Note 3 of 2020, small‑ticket investments and stakes up to 10% may now receive automatic approval, with clearer beneficial ownership rules.
